SCHOOL COUNCIL

 

In 2000-2001, the Ontario government took significant steps to ensure that parents, through their school councils, would have greater influence in their children’s education. Regulations were created that confirm the advisory role of school councils and clearly state that their purpose is to improve student achievement and enhance the accountability of the education system to parents. School councils are now able to make recommendations to their principals and school boards on any matter. Principals and school boards, in turn, must consult with school councils on a variety of matters that affect student learning. They must also consider recommendations made by school councils and report back to the councils on how they plan to act. Council members are elected for a term that lasts from the first meeting of one school year to the first meeting of the next. Ideally, each council will reflect the diversity of its school community. Parents and guardians must form the majority of members on the council. All members may bring before the council the issues and concerns of the groups that they represent and provide links to those groups.

Ontario Regulation 612/00 establishes that a school council will consist of the following members:

* A majority of parents  
* The principal or vice-principal of the school  
* One teacher employed in the school  
* One non-teaching employee of the school  
* One student in the case of secondary schools (optional for elementary)  
* One or more community representatives appointed by the elected council (including parish representative)  
* One person appointed by an association that is a member of the Ontario Association of Par- ents in Catholic Education
